The CPS Solutions, LLC Health Equity and Systems Thinking Pharmacy Fellowship is aimed to position our graduates to improve health equity through advocacy, recognition of systems thinking, and adoption of community resources/partnerships to improve chronic conditions. You will focus on addressing and improving healthcare disparities with the aim of a more culturally competent pharmacist workforce in integrating social determinants of health screening and interventions into medication use encounters and improving patient outcomes.

This is a 12-month position only. Additional time may be added as needed and will be determined by the end of the term.

The Pharmacy Fellowship is a 12-month, full-time program starting in August 2026 with the schedule being a minimum of 40 hours per week, Monday - Friday, and occasional weekends as needed.

Primary Responsibilities:
  • Analyze an assessment that incorporates structural and process of care indicators to improve health literacy and communication between pharmacy and patients during the medication management encounter
    • Collect and analyze patient population data for the health system or organization
    • Collaborate with departmental and/or interdisciplinary teams in the design, implementation, and/or enhancement of the organization's criteria for appropriate medication use management
    • Increase knowledge about social determinants of health (SDOH) and disparities in health care and explore attitudes and behaviors that promote and/or mitigate disparities in patient care
  • Conduct a longitudinal research and quality improvement project for presentation at a professional platform
    • Assess the health system (or department) for components of health literacy
    • Implement systems thinking-based evaluation design and intervention design
    • Evaluate opportunities for improving patient outcomes, clinical and operational efficiencies, safety and quality of the medication-use process through the application of Continuous Quality Improvement (CQI) strategies
  • Develop a structural Certificate Program in the area of health equity, disparity and systems thinking for preceptors and pharmacist leaders
    • Assist the organization in achieving compliance with accreditation, legal, regulatory, and safety requirements related to the use of medications (e.g., appropriate accrediting bodies and related professional organization standards, statements, and/or guidelines; state and federal laws regulating pharmacy practice)
    • Provide effective medication and practice-related education to health care professionals in health equity standards and systems thinking

Required Qualifications:
  • Minimum of a bachelor's degree from an American Council on Pharmaceutical Education (ACPE) accredited college or university (Pharm

    D preferred)
  • Licensure in good standing as a Registered Pharmacist prior to the program start date; willingness to reciprocate
  • Post-graduate pharmacy residency (PGY1) or equivalent training
  • Must include curriculum vitae (CV), a personal letter of intent, transcript and the names and contact information of three individuals that can provide professional letters of recommendation as part of the application
  • Driver's License and access to reliable transportation
Preferred Qualifications:
  • Doctor of Pharmacy (Pharm

    D)
  • Degree in Public Health or work experience in public health services
  • Possess necessary knowledge to provide oversight of medication regimens for the patient populations treated in the facility, including a knowledge of dosing for specific age populations
  • Proven effective interpersonal and communication skills - verbal and written
  • Proficiency with pharmacy computer systems
  • Proficiency with Outlook, Word, PowerPoint and Excel
  • Ability to collaborate effectively with all levels across the organization.
